About ethyl (E)-4-[[(E)-6,6-dimethyl-5-(methylamino)-2-propan-2-ylhept-3-enoyl]-methylamino]-2,5-dimethylhex-2-enoate

ethyl (E)-4-[[(E)-6,6-dimethyl-5-(methylamino)-2-propan-2-ylhept-3-enoyl]-methylamino]-2,5-dimethylhex-2-enoate (PubChem CID 21031980) has the molecular formula C24H44N2O3 and a molecular weight of 408.63 g/mol. Its IUPAC name is ethyl (E)-4-[[(E)-6,6-dimethyl-5-(methylamino)-2-propan-2-ylhept-3-enoyl]-methylamino]-2,5-dimethylhex-2-enoate.
